- 25 jul 2017, 11:48
#69869
De beta versie van de WXSIM scripts is nu ook toegevoegd op https://leuven-template.eu/wsfct4/
De download is hierop ook aangepast.
NIEUW: De WXSIM scripts maken als eerste gebruik van een andere methode voor het "cachen".[ol][li]Je kunt, zoals de meeste scripts doen, het verwachtingen bestand (xml) bewaren in de cache[/li][li]of je bewaart de in PHP-scripts aangemaakte PHP-tabel voor de volgende gebruiker[/li][li]of je bewaart ook de aangemaakte html[/li][/ol]Alle toekomstige versies van mijn scripts bewaren voortaan de gemaakte html. Met een klein nadeel, je moet per gebruikte taal een versie bewaren.
Voordeel, tot 80% reductie in CPU tijd op de server nadat de xml is opgehaald.
Een verwachtingen script moet immers
=> xml laden van de externe server
=> de xml interpreteren
=> de gebruikte units aanpassen naar de standaard units of de door bezoeker gevraagde units
=> deze informatie opslaan voor een volgend gebruik
=> de html genereren
De meeste tijd gaat zitten in het wachten op de externe server.
Daarna zit meeste CPU tijd EN doorlooptijd op de eigen server in de vele PHP instructies die voor iedere verwachtingsregel worden doorlopen.
De download is hierop ook aangepast.
NIEUW: De WXSIM scripts maken als eerste gebruik van een andere methode voor het "cachen".[ol][li]Je kunt, zoals de meeste scripts doen, het verwachtingen bestand (xml) bewaren in de cache[/li][li]of je bewaart de in PHP-scripts aangemaakte PHP-tabel voor de volgende gebruiker[/li][li]of je bewaart ook de aangemaakte html[/li][/ol]Alle toekomstige versies van mijn scripts bewaren voortaan de gemaakte html. Met een klein nadeel, je moet per gebruikte taal een versie bewaren.
Voordeel, tot 80% reductie in CPU tijd op de server nadat de xml is opgehaald.
Een verwachtingen script moet immers
=> xml laden van de externe server
=> de xml interpreteren
=> de gebruikte units aanpassen naar de standaard units of de door bezoeker gevraagde units
=> deze informatie opslaan voor een volgend gebruik
=> de html genereren
De meeste tijd gaat zitten in het wachten op de externe server.
Daarna zit meeste CPU tijd EN doorlooptijd op de eigen server in de vele PHP instructies die voor iedere verwachtingsregel worden doorlopen.